E-commerce Complaint Process: Steps and Resources

Navigating an e-commerce complaint procedure can be challenging, but understanding the actions and available resources is essential to resolving issues. Initially, check your order details and the retailer's terms regarding returns, refunds, and dispute resolution. If the issue persists, contact the vendor directly through their site’s customer support. Many retailers have a dedicated feedback form for submitting your concerns. If the early contact proves unsuccessful, escalate the problem to the digital store, such as Amazon, eBay, or Etsy, which often has its own dispute program. Finally, if all else proves unsuccessful, consider filing a complaint with consumer protection agencies or, as a last resort, pursuing legal guidance.

Online Shopping Gone Wrong? Your Complaint Options Explained

So, you've encountered a problem with an digital purchase? Perhaps your item arrived faulty, or it was utterly different from what was described? Don't despair! You have several paths for lodging a grievance. First, contact the merchant directly through their website. Many businesses have specialized customer support departments to handle these situations. If that fails, consider making a dispute with your payment provider – they often provide protection against deceptive transactions. Finally, you can consider options like the Better Business Bureau or online review platforms to voice your feedback and potentially find a settlement. Remember to preserve all correspondence and evidence related to the order.
